Gloria Anderson

Gloria Anderson is an Americana and Country singer-songwriter from Luling, Texas. As a military brat she wrote songs about her window observations during six family moves before seventh grade. After settling in Texas, Gloria began playing her music around the hill country. Her talents are on full display in the Lone Star State, as she is the first rising Texas songwriter to sell out the Hill Top Cafe, and she’s featured in the BMI Saxon Pub songwriter showcase. Gloria’s newest hometown is Nashville, Tennessee, where she studied the craft of songwriting at Belmont University on her way to receiving Warner Chappell’s 2022-2023 Songwriting Internship and winning Belmont’s 2022 ASCAP Songwriters Showcase. She has since performed at the Bluebird Cafe, the PNC Plaza Stage at the Ryman, Gruene Hall, 3rd and Lindsley and more. In 2024 she is set to perform at the Key West Songwriters Festival, Fernandina Songwriters Fest, Schulenburg’s Songwriter Serenade and the New Smyrna Beach Songwriters Festival. Her songs have been featured on an assortment of playlists: Spotify’s New Music Nashville and Fresh Finds: Country, Apple Music’s Don’t Mess With Texas, and BMI’s Texas Ten. Gloria’s music combines her humble Texas roots with relatable lyrics to create her image as an empowering girl-next-door who always has a story to tell.
